American Bird Conservancy (ABC) and its partners are pleased to introduce the Conservation Birding web site that allows birders to find lodges that contribute to bird conservation in the Americas. Each reserve that has a web page on this site has been designed to support the long-term protection of habitat for rare birds, with direct support from ABC, and is run by a local conservation group. When you visit, you know that the fees you pay contribute directly to the management of vital bird habitat.
  So please browse the reserves and routes featured on the top left menu, go birding, and save species!

Booking and partner details are provided on each reserve’s page. These reserves are also on the itineraries of a number of major tour operators, so please check with your tour company about specific itineraries. Additional reserves will be added as this site expands.
